The “per mile extra” charge typically applies to standard fuel fees, local taxes, or service access costs not included in the base rental price. When booking, fees can vary based on vehicle type, location, rental duration, and added services—like insurance or child seats. Most major providers include variable mileage charges that reflect distance driven, fuel spillage, or route-specific levies, with standard rates averaging between $0.10 to $0.50 per mile depending on demand and location. These fees are généralement applied only when total driving exceeds a set allowance, often starting around 10–15% over a free mileage threshold. The fee structure is designed to offset operational costs while remaining transparent in pricing disclosures—though full breakdowns vary by provider.
